The Green Monster AKA Spica cast

It was about 12:30am on November 6th when JT's cast was finally on. They brought him back to us and we waited for a room. We were going to be there at least overnight. The cast looked huge, frigthening. I didn't want to pick him up because I was afraid I was going to hurt him. 
 We shared a room with another family who was also experiencing life with a Spica cast and JT and their son took turns moaning, crying, whining throughout the night in pain. The only way to calm JT down was for me to rub his head continously and squeeze him a little when he spasmed, as if to let him know I was still there. We were up all night and the pain was still there. We had hoped once his leg was set, the spasms would stop and the pain would ease a little, but throughout that first night he was in horrible pain.
